The Morning Bottleneck on the Service Drive

When a vehicle arrives on the drive, the clock starts ticking. Customers want to hand over their keys and get to work, while advisors are trying to juggle customer concerns, look up vehicle history, and write up clean repair orders. Under this time pressure, thorough intake becomes nearly impossible.

For instance, when a customer drops off a vehicle for automotive air conditioning repair during peak summer heat, a rushed advisor might write a vague three-word description on the ticket. The technician in the bay then receives a repair order with minimal detail, forcing them to perform duplicate diagnostic work or chase down the advisor for clarification. Meanwhile, open factory recalls sit unflagged in the system, and mileage-based maintenance opportunities vanish because no one had time to review the service history during check-in.

This friction damages customer satisfaction scores, slows down bay throughput, and creates unnecessary stress across fixed operations. When advisors spend their mornings entering repetitive data, customer conversations become transactional and hurried.

AI for Automotive Service Technicians: How Automated Intake Works

A digital service advisor changes the shape of intake by starting the work long before the customer arrives on the drive. When a customer contacts the dealership early in the morning or books online, the AI employee instantly pulls the vehicle history from the dealer management system, checks for open safety recalls, and pre-populates the repair order.

Understanding the difference between automotive and automation technology is crucial here. Basic dealership software simply stores data until a human enters it. An AI employee actively manages the workflow by generating diagnostic tickets, attaching recall notices, and notifying advisors of recommended services based on vehicle mileage.

When the vehicle arrives, the advisor simply confirms the pre-built order, collects the keys, and welcomes the customer. The technician receives a detailed, accurate ticket with complete historical notes, allowing repair work to begin without delay.
